A word from the director: If you are anything like me, I've been thinking that it "should" be getting easier since this stay at home stuff is the new normal. That does not seem to be happening for me, and maybe you are experiencing that as well. I've heard from a number of people that last week was REALLY rough. It was rough for me as well, and I've got lots of skills to use and access (virtually, mostly) to supportive people. My kids started having more difficulties, my ...wife and I had some interpersonal problems. There was more irritability in my home. It was harder for me to be skillful, and I've been practicing the skills we teach for years (You may be having a similar experience, or maybe your experience is way more intense.) If you are loving this stay at home thing, maybe you can teach the rest of us something. I'm also experiencing some screen fatigue. I do a lot of Zooming, and it is rather exhausting to be "on" all that time. Parenting, also, has seemed to become harder. I don't have the same support I used to. The kids don't have the interactions with their peers that they used to. Your stress may be going up, the stress your kids are experiencing may be going up, and nobody knows when the end is. What I'm about to announce may seem like one more thing to do, and I want you to consider something before you say, "I just can't do one more thing." When we run a Zoom group teaching skills and giving support here at LifeWork, we often notice people showing up looking tired. Sometimes REALLY tired. By the end of those groups, however, most of the time we notice more energy, people say they are glad they participated, and people are often leaving the meetings HOPEFUL. Lifework's Coping through a Pandemic for Pre-Teens (ages 10 to 14) helps young people learn about their strong emotions and cope with life while under stay-at-home orders. Preteens will learn skills to help with decreasing their anxiety, reducing impulsive behaviors, and coping through this difficult time. We will be meeting online for six weeks starting April 16th at 6:45 p.m. This group is open to any pre-teen individuals and one parent/guardian who would like to learn additional skills to cope while acclimating to life during a pandemic.
